Eerie Parallels

This is currently flying around the Internet. I did not create this. It is a list of parallels between the fall of the Miami dynasty of the early 2000's and the current fall of the recent USC dynasty.


Miami ( 2000-2004 )

00 : 11-1
01 : 12-0
02 : 12-1
03 : 11-2
04 : 9-3

* 34 Game Win Streak
* Appeared in back-to-back BCS National Title games
* Lost 34 game win streak in 2nd National Title game appearance
* 4 straight BCS bids
* Located near an ocean
* Played home games in a stadium vacated by an NFL team
* In the 4th year of their "Dynasty", a 5* QB from Shreveport Evangel Christian High School became the starter.
* In said 4th year the 5* QB who took over was the #1 QB in his recruiting class ( Berlin ).
* The last name of that same 5* QB from Evangel Christian High started with the letter "B"
* In the same 4th year of their "Dynasty" they had a back up QB that was a 5* who happened to be from California.
* In the same 4th year that backup 5* QB who was from California was the former #1 Pro-Style QB and #1 QB overall in the country.
* Were 6-2 overall after 8 games in 2004
* In their 5th year ( 2004 ) they lost their 2nd game of the year by the score of 24-17.
* In their 5th year ( 2004 ) they scored 27 points in their 4th game of the year.
* In their first BCS championship game, Miami pounded a Big 12 team wearing red (Nebraska).
* In their second BCS championship game, they were defeated very late in the game (Ohio State).
* Miami's loss total went as follows: 1-0-1-2-3
* Miami lost those games in the following seasons as follows:

00 : Road ( v. Pac-10 team )
01 : None
02 : None ( Minus their 2nd National Title game bowl appearance )
03 : Road & Home
04 : Road, Home, Home


USC ( 2003-2007 )

03 : 12-1
04 : 13-0
05 : 12-1
06 : 11-2
07 : 6-2

* 34 Game Win Streak
* Appeared in back-to-back BCS National Title games
* Lost 34 game win streak in 2nd National Title game appearance
* 4 straight BCS bids
* Located near an ocean
* Played home games in a stadium vacated by an NFL team (in this case, two NFL teams)
* In the 4th year of their "Dynasty", a 5* QB from Shreveport Evangel Christian High School became the starter.
* In said 4th year the 5* QB who took over was the #1 QB in his recruiting class ( Booty ).
* The last name of that same 5* QB from Evangel Christian High started with the letter "B"
* In the same 4th year of their "Dynasty" they had a back up QB who was a 5* who happened to be from California.
* In the same 4th year that backup 5* QB who was from California was the former #1 Pro-Style QB and #1 QB overall in the country.
* Were 6-2 overall after 8 games in 2004
* In their 5th year ( 2007 ) they lost their 2nd game of the year by the score of 24-17.
* In their 5th year ( 2007 ) they scored 27 points in their 4th game of the year.
* In their first BCS championship game, USC pounded a Big 12 team wearing red (Oklahoma).
* In their second BCS championship game, they were defeated very late in the game (Texas).
* USC's loss total went as follows: 1-0-1-2-( sits at 2 currently )
* USC lost those games in the following seasons as follows:

03 : Road ( v. Pac 10 team )
04 : None
05 : None ( Minus their 2nd National Title game bowl appearance )
06 : Road & "Road" played game in CA v. UCLA with a 50/50 split SC/UCLA fans
07 : Road, Home ( SC has 2 home games left - Ore St & UCLA )
